WebJun 20, 2024 · Ubrelvy and Emgality are both migraine medications that are called Calcitonin Gene-Related Peptide (CGRP) inhibitors. They differ in that Ubrelvy (ubrogepant) treats a migraine when you have one, where Emgality (galcanezumab) is used to prevent migraines. WebSep 28, 2024 · The newest oral drugs for the acute treatment of migraine are Nurtec ODT ( rimegepant) and Ubrelvy ( ubrogepant ), both orally-administered calcitonin gene-related peptide (CGRP) receptor antagonists (gepants). Another new drug for the acute treatment of migraine is Reyvow ( lasmiditan ), the first serotonin (5-HT) 1F receptor agonist.
